RESOLUTION NO. 80 -26 A RESOLUTION APPROVING WATER DISTRICT NO. 10's RESOLUTION NO. 276, DATED MARCH 19, 1980, AMENDMENT TO THE COMPREHENSIVE PLAN OF WATER DISTRICT NO. 10 IT IS HEREBY RESOLVED that the Whatcom County Council does approve the amendment to the Comprehensive Plan of Water District No. 10 as it applies to Whatcom County, in Resolution No. 276, dated march 19, 1980. It is hereby provided that the amendment to the plan shall be subject to such changes as to details of aqueduct or pipe size or location or any other details of said plan as may be author- ized by the Board either prior to or during the actual course of construction. The District may proceed with the construction and installa- tion of the improvements included in amendment to the plan as herein authorized, either alone or in conjunction with the constructi. of other facilities of the District, and in. whole, or in successive parts or units from time to time as may be found advisable. Section 2., The estimated cost of the acquisition, construc- tion and installation of the improvements included in such amendment to the plan is hereby declared to be, as near as may be, the sum of $ which shall be provided for out of moneys accumulated in the maintenance fund in excess of the requirements of such fund for payment of operating and maintenance expenses and redemption or sezvicing of outstanding obligations of the District.
